Nikhef (https://www.nikhef.nl/) is the national institute for subatomic physics in the Netherlands. At Nikhef, approximately 175 physicists and 75 technical staff members work together in an open and international scientific environment. Together, they perform theoretical and experimental research in the fields of particle- and astroparticle physics. Nikhef hosts a well staffed theoretical physics group, which collaborates closely with the experimental groups. Among the research collaborations Nikhef participates in are the ATLAS, LHCb and ALICE experiments at CERN, the KM3NeT neutrino telescope in the Mediterranean, the VIRGO interferometer in Pisa, the XENONnT dark matter experiment in Gran Sasso and the Pierre Auger cosmic ray observatory in Argentina.


The group
The activities of the Nikhef theory group  (https://www.nikhef.nl/pub/theory/general.html/) include higher order calculations and jet physics in perturbative Quantum Chromodynamics, parton distribution functions, 3D imaging of the proton, flavour physics, gravity, and cosmology, among others. The Nikhef theory group and Nikhef as a laboratory provide a very stimulating environment with many seminars, colloquia, and journal clubs meetings, including also various interactions with the experimental groups.
